Title: Reset-link tokens accepted after password change during flow revamp

While revamping the Bramblegate password reset flow, we found that tokens issued before a successful reset remain valid until natural expiry. The old flow invalidated all outstanding tokens on completion; the new handler skips that step because token revocation moved to a separate service and the call was never wired up. Repro: request two reset links, complete one, use the other — it works. Fix should restore revocation-on-success. First affected build is noted below.

build token for kagaf-hahof: htk14_9d3d4d26d7d8de

Test plan: intermittent DNS failures in Quillbay batch jobs

For the release manager: jobs fail ~2% of runs with resolution timeouts against the internal resolver. Plan: pin resolver in the job image, add retry with jitter, rerun the nightly suite 50x. Results post to the metrics endpoint, which requires bearer auth; the staging token is below.

bearer token for kagap-fawef: eyJhbGciOiJIUzI1NiIsInR5cCI6IkpXVCJ9.eyJzdWIiOiIcaYGydIn0.boChePUA

Action item: Following the Harrowgate outage, we must complete the leaked-file-descriptor hunt before the next release candidate is cut. Dmitri's team has instrumented the Copperline daemon to log descriptor counts per subsystem; early data points to the retry path in the archive uploader. Please hold the release train until the audit closes and the fix lands. Full findings and tracking status are documented on the internal page below.

wiki page, tahaf-tajog: https://jira.ordindyn.corp/pipeline